Output 8ec624287a219ac8949084b73e5894be5be29fd27fc618df0b208fb29b0f6427:1

value
292082
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4382080def5893404219e4d7848491ec603f2be6 OP_EQUALVERIFY OP_CHECKSIG
address
179x3bdUtbyPpVEt74UUzpcMkEBCwzrVNB
transaction
8ec624287a219ac8949084b73e5894be5be29fd27fc618df0b208fb29b0f6427
spent
true